Clurichaun's Mischief was originally crafted as a special small batch stout for Irish Fest 2022 at Twelve Percent Beer Project. We scaled it up to a proper size and what did not make it into barrels was rested on Coffee, Cacao nibs, vanilla, and Irish Cream Flavor (Dairy Free). Keep a close watch on your vintage beer or wine collection, you never know when the Clurichaun’s mischief will lead him down into your cellar.

473ml can. Jet black colour with minimally late awakening, small to average, frothy to creamy, half-way lasting, minimally lacing, brown head. Relatively cautious, sweet-ish, slightly roasty, dark malty and slightly caramel malty, minimally spicy aroma, notes of dark chocolate, dark caramel, vanilla, hints of coffee, cocoa, weak fruity and spicy overtones with a touch of blueberry, cinnamon, cherry, nuts, toffee. Taste is sweet-ish, chocolately, dark malty, fruity and slightly alcoholic, minimally spicy, notes of vanilla, cocoa, dark chocolate, some toffee, blueberry, honey, cherry, plum wine; warming, alcoholic finish. Viscous texture, smooth, soft and silky palate, very fine, dense, soft carbonation. Rich and intense, complex, maybe a tad too boozy - pretty good.
